Seeing Life as an Artist. Sunday, July 4, 2010. 2010 Roan Moutain Trip. It was the beginning of a glorious day. After recovering physically from our climb on Grassy Ridge at 6,200 above sea level, I painted this 8 x 10 oil study in the morning low light at about 8:45am. Though the Rhododendron bloom was early this year, I used my artist license to add in these blooms. I just thought they ought to be there. Seeing Life as an Artist. Sunday, September 16, 2012. Painting The Linville Gorge. On Tuesday Sept 11, 2012, Craig Franz, Kevin Beck and I descended into the Linville Gorge for a day of painting. We had a cloudy start in the morning during my 1st painting. 8 x 10 oil morning study, everything was very subtle and I added a little break in the overcast to create some interest and made the distant mountain more purple relating to the sky color.
